14 Information Services and Systems I have a search strategy – what’s next?

15 Information Services and Systems To get the best out of a search strategy you need to control how you use your search terms These search tools will help: Combining terms using AND, OR, NOT Using the Phrase Search Using the Truncation Symbol Using the Wildcard Symbol

16 Information Services and Systems AND AimSearch ExamplesResults To focus your search results & Link your terms problems AND families dysfunction AND child conflict AND homes Only retrieves results containing both keywords

17 Information Services and Systems OR AimSearch ExamplesResults To broaden your search results & OR will help you to search for related terms & synonyms conflict OR problems intervention OR conflict resolution Children OR siblings Retrieves results containing either of your keywords

18 Information Services and Systems NOT AimSearch ExamplesResults To exclude a term from your search Wales NOT Australia sibling NOT twins Will exclude records containing the second term

19 Information Services and Systems Phase search Use quotation marks “ ” to keep keywords together e.g. “child protection” “elder abuse” “British association of social work”

20 Information Services and Systems Truncation symbol * child* child children childhood

21 Information Services and Systems Wildcard symbol ? Behavio?r BehaviourBehavior

23 Information Services and Systems Too few results? Try … Check the thesaurus; terminology can differ Use the truncation symbol Combine your keywords with OR

24 Information Services and Systems Too many results? Try … adding additional search terms with AND use more specific keywords use refining/filter menus within the search tool

31 Information Services and Systems Choosing the right search tool It’s not a good idea to rely on Google Google has many disadvantages -you will receive an unmanageable number of results -will give irrelevant & inappropriate results -not everything will be free of charge -there is no quality control

32 Information Services and Systems Evaluating Web Resources : Key questions to ask : The Five Ws Who wrote the information? What is the purpose of the site? When was the content created? Where does the information come from? Why is this information useful to me?

33 Information Services and Systems Why academic databases are a better choice Indexing is entrusted to people not search engines They index academic quality publications e.g. Journal articles, Conference papers A large proportion of the content is from peer reviewed journals
